5 Peverell Gardens is an impressive four bedroom detached property built to a high specification with appealing and contemporary finishes throughout and is well-suited to a variety of modern lifestyles.

A panelled door accesses the spacious reception hall which has stairs rising to the first floor with oak handrails and oak doors to a principal reception room which is situated to the front of the property which has an attractive bay window with views to the front, and a second door accessing a well appointed cloakroom with a tiled floor, vanity unit with storage beneath and matching WC. There is also a useful understairs storage cupboard.

An oak door leads to the particularly impressive kitchen/breakfast/family room which has a part vaulted ceiling, bifold doors leading to an extensive terrace beyond which are beautiful field views, a tiled floor, and a particularly impressive kitchen with a range of floor and wall mounted units with quartz worktops and upstands, integral appliances to include an oven and separate grill, fridge/freezer, dishwasher, hob with extractor hood above, sink and drainer. There are two Velux roof lights making this a lovely bright room. A second oak door opens to a well-appointed utility room which is fitted with the same units and worktops as the kitchen and has space for a washing machine and tumble dryer and a door to the outside.

The first floor is equally appealing with an attractive galleried landing with a door leading to a spacious linen cupboard. The principal bedroom is situated to the front elevation of the property and has views over looking the village and a door opens to a lavishly appointed ensuite shower room with a rectangular vanity unit with storage beneath, matching WC and oversized walk in shower cubicle. There are three remaining generously proportioned bedrooms, one to the front and two to the rear elevations with those at the rear having spectacular views over open countryside. These three bedrooms are served by a well appointed bath/shower room which is fully tiled and has a shower above the bath, rectangular sink with vanity storage beneath and a matching WC.

Outside
The property is approached via an extensive area of parking and in turn leads to the single garage with an electric roller door and side personnel door. The sandstone path leads to the front door and also allows rear access. Accessed from the breakfast/family room is an impressive terrace beyond which are large expanses of garden with open field views in the distance.
